A Locking Protocol For Resource Coordination In Distributed Databases

Summary: Centralized locking for distributed DBs; partition-tolerant, enabling local work and reconnection merge. Supports locking disciplines and communication, with three recovery modes: single-node, partition merge, controller reconstruction. (summarized by gpt-5-nano on Feb 09 2026)
